Afghanistan is the top-ranked Associate nation in T20s

Eight of the top Associate nations will participate in the inaugural Desert T20 tournament, set to start on January 14. Afghanistan, Hong Kong, Ireland, Namibia, Netherlands, Oman, Scotland, and the UAE will be the participating nations, with the matches set to be hosted in Abu Dhabi and Dubai.

"Emirates Cricket Board are delighted to collaborate with the participating Associates to bring this inaugural T20 tournament to the UAE," said Zayed Abbas, Emirates Cricket Board Member. "The aim of the tournament is to provide an opportunity for our teams to play more competitive Men's T20 cricket. Each of the participating countries are very close in ICC T20I rankings, so we expect the quality of cricket to be very strong."

Afghanistan (9), Ireland (17), Namibia (NR), and the UAE (14) are drawn in Pool A, while Netherlands (11), Scotland (13), Oman (16) and Hong Kong (15) will be in Pool B. Two teams will qualify from each group for the semi-finals.

"With the world-class practice facilities and playing surfaces available to us in the UAE, we are confident each Associate will benefit greatly from this tournament. We extend our sincere thanks to the participating Unions, the ICC and the ICC Academy for their support and commitment to this tournament," Abbas added.

The seven-day tournament will be played from January 14-17 in Abu Dhabi, before moving to Dubai on January 18. The finals and the semifinals will be played on January 20 at the Dubai International Cricket Stadium.
